5 Reasons to Use Mailgun

1) It Fits Into Almost Any Type of Business

When the original developers wrote the Mailgun API, they were concerned about compatibility. They didn’t want to make a system that could only be used by people who had installed specific other tools. You’re free to integrate Mailgun-based tools into your current workflows regardless of what kinds of technology you’re currently using. In fact, you shouldn’t have much of an issue even if you couldn’t name one single underlying module your eCommerce site uses for email marketing!

2) It Automatically Adds Unsubscribe Links to Your Messages

Having read that, you’re more than likely thinking that’s a drawback. Nobody should have to sort through unwanted email, though, so giving your customers an opt-out process is a humongous boost to your firm’s reputation. Perhaps most importantly, though, many inbox services consider automated mail without any unsubscribe links to be junk. This feature ensures that your clients get a chance to read your message, and that can really help conversion rates over the long haul.

3) You Don’t Like Bots

Assume for a moment that you run a site that gets a fair number of people to sign up or schedule for something on a daily basis. Eventually you spot a huge spike in this already large value. Would your site be able to handle some sort of haywire bot artificially spamming you with traffic for no reason? The Mailgun API includes an integrated email validation system that can help protect your forms from crawling bots.

4) You Want to Enjoy the Freedom that Comes with Automatic Logging

Wouldn’t it be nice to see just how many emails you’ve sent without having to look through your outbox all of the time? If you’re trying to keep track of metric data for analytic reasons, then you’re probably especially concerned with this kind of thing. Mailgun automatically keeps track of everything you send out, so you can go back and take a look later on.

5) You Don’t Want to Worry About Messages Getting Lost

How are you supposed to improve your conversion rates if you can’t even be sure that your emails are reaching their destination? Mailgun ensures that emails sent out from your site end up inside of inboxes rather than spam folders. If you’ve been burned in the past because of server configuration issues and overactive spam filters, then you should find that these things aren’t much of an issue in the world of Mailgun technology. It’s also fully SMTP compatible, so you won’t have to worry about setting things up on your end either. Unlike PHP-based technology, messages sent through Mailgun aren’t immediately treated as spam by most services.
